Mind Games: Intelligence Analysis

LabelInformation
  Dates & times
  • Thu, 07/22/2021 - 2:00pm
  Category
  Age Groups

 

Spies go out into the world to collect secrets, but without analysis, there is no real meaning. Analysts comb through collected intel to find connections and patterns, sniff out deception, and give context – all while avoiding the mental traps that can skew their results. In a highly interactive program where students are polled for their decisions and observations, discuss options, and form conclusions – they will test their analytical skills, reveal their cognitive biases, and dive into the world of intelligence analysis!

Responding to the Climate Emergency

LabelInformation
  Dates & times
  • Thu, 07/29/2021 - 2:00pm
  Category
  Age Groups

 

Tim Pritchard, Sustainability Coordinator with Five Rivers MetroParks, will discuss what it means to have a climate emergency and what we understand needs to happen according to science to address the circumstance. The conversation will focus both on the big picture actions that need to be taken worldwide and what individuals can do at home and in the community to support real change.
